Abstract

The viscosity of glasses in the systems As-Se and As-Se-X (X=I, S) was measured by the beam-bending method in the transition region ranging approximately from the transition temperature to the deformation temperature. The plots of the logarithm of the viscosity versus the reciprocal of the absolute temperature gave essentially straight lines for all samples. The apparent activation energy for the viscous flow of glass was calculated from the linear relation shown in Figs. 1, 2 and 3 by the equation ΔE=R d(logη)/d(1/T), where R is the gas constant. The results are shown in Figs. 5 and 6. Also the delayed elasticity becomes evident in the transition region for the glasses in the systems As-Se and As-Se-S, as shown in Figs. 8 and 9.
